阿里云服务器安装mysql5.7

您可以按照以下步骤在阿里云服务器上安装MySQL 5.7:

  1. 登录到阿里云服务器,可以使用SSH登录或者控制台的远程连接功能。
  2. 更新系统软件包列表:

    sudo apt update
  3. 安装MySQL服务器:

    sudo apt install mysql-server
  4. 安装过程中会提示您设置MySQL的root密码,请设置一个强密码并记住它。
  5. 安装完成后,启动MySQL服务:

    sudo systemctl start mysql
  6. 如果需要MySQL开机自启动,运行以下命令:

    sudo systemctl enable mysql
  7. 配置MySQL安全性:

    sudo mysql_secure_installation

    这个命令会提示您进行一些安全性配置,如禁用匿名用户、不允许远程root登录等,按照提示进行相应的设置即可。

至此,您已经成功安装了MySQL 5.7。您可以使用以下命令来验证MySQL服务的运行状态:

sudo systemctl status mysql

如果MySQL服务正在运行,您应该能够看到类似以下输出:

● mysql.service - MySQL Community Server
   Loaded: loaded (/lib/systemd/system/mysql.service; enabled; vendor preset: enabled)
   Active: active (running) since Wed 2021-01-01 00:00:00 UTC; 1min ago

如果状态显示Active: active (running),那么表示MySQL服务正常运行。

另外,如果您需要从本地连接到远程MySQL服务器,您还需要修改MySQL的配置文件,允许远程连接。

  1. 编辑MySQL的配置文件:

    s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f
  2. 找到该文件中的bind-address行,并将其注释掉(在行的前面添加#)或者将其值更改为服务器的公共IP地址。
  3. 保存并关闭文件,然后重启MySQL服务:

    sudo systemctl restart mysql

这样,您就可以使用远程客户端连接到该MySQL服务器了。在连接时,请使用服务器的公共IP地址和MySQL的root用户名和密码。

以下是在阿里云服务器上安装MySQL 5.7的步骤:

  1. 连接到服务器:使用SSH连接到你的阿里云服务器。
  2. 下载MySQL的安装包:你可以从MySQL官方网站下载适合你操作系统的安装包。打开MySQL下载页面(https://dev.mysql.com/downloads/mysql/),找到MySQL Community Server的部分,并选择适合你操作系统的版本。点击“Download”按钮下载安装包。
  3. 安装MySQL:将下载的安装包传输到你的服务器上,并解压缩它。你可以使用以下命令进行解压缩,其中mysql-5.7.**-linux-x86_64.tar.gz是你下载的安装包的文件名。如果你的安装包名称不同,请相应地修改命令:

    tar -zxvf mysql-5.7.**-linux-x86_64.tar.gz
  4. 移动安装文件:解压缩后,你会得到一个名为mysql-5.7.**-linux-x86_64的目录。使用以下命令将该目录移动到/usr/local目录下:

    mv mysql-5.7.**-linux-x86_64 /usr/local/mysql
  5. 创建MySQL用户和组:运行以下命令创建一个名为mysql的用户和组:

    groupadd mysql
    useradd -r -g mysql -s /bin/false mysql
  6. 更改数据目录的权限:使用以下命令更改MySQL数据目录(通常为/var/lib/mysql)的权限:

    chown -R mysql:mysql /var/lib/mysql
  7. 初始化MySQL:运行以下命令初始化MySQL:

    cd /usr/local/mysql
    bin/mysql_install_db --user=mysql --basedir=/usr/local/mysql --datadir=/var/lib/mysql
  8. 启动MySQL:执行以下命令启动MySQL:

    bin/mysqld_safe --user=mysql &
  9. 运行安全脚本:运行以下命令设置MySQL的根密码和其他安全设置:

    阿里云服务器安装mysql5.7
    bin/mysql_secure_installation

    你将会被提示输入根密码、删除匿名用户、禁止远程根登录等选项。请根据自己的需求进行设置。

  10. 测试MySQL:通过以下命令测试MySQL是否正常运行:

    bin/mysql -u root -p

    稍后会要求你输入根密码。如果一切正常,你将进入MySQL的命令行界面。

恭喜,你已成功在阿里云服务器上安装了MySQL 5.7!

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/34225.html

(0)
luotuoemo的头像luotuoemo
上一篇 2023年9月12日 15:39
下一篇 2023年9月12日 15:51

相关推荐

  • 东营阿里云代理商:app未读消息 数据库

    设计方案 方案一: 在数据库中创建一张user表和一张message表。 user表用于存储用户信息,包括用户ID、用户名、密码等。 message表用于存储每个用户的未读消息,包括消息ID、用户ID、消息内容、发送时间、状态等。 当用户打开app时,查询该用户在数据库中的未读消息数,将未读消息数显示在界面上。 当用户读取一条消息时,将该消息状态设为已读,并…

    2024年3月8日
    68700
  • 阿里云计算员工待遇

    阿里云计算有限公司怎么样,技术如何?像工程师的话一般工资待遇怎么样? 那要看你的资历了 一般也在8k了做一份工作赚不赚钱,除了你本身的工作能力以外,还要看你的付出与回报是否相等。如果你能力再强,做事再多,成绩再好,得到的回报太低,那么你是无法在这家企业长期做下去的。一家好的企业一定会注重员工的价值回报,如果企业只是注重老板赚钱,而不管员工死活,那么这样的工作…

    2023年8月28日
    74400
  • 阿里云国际站注册教程:apache 数据库项目

    这个项目涉及的内容比较多,包括云服务器搭建、Apache安装、数据库安装以及项目部署。我将逐步向您解释可将整个项目的具体步骤: 登录阿里云国际站: 登录https://www.alibabacloud.com/网址,点击右上角的“Free Account”以创建免费帐户。 创建阿里云ECS实例云服务器: 在阿里云官方控制台,选择“Elastic Comput…

    2024年3月23日
    69600
  • 台州阿里云代理商:阿里云 小ai

    阿里云:引领云计算时代的领先之选 1. 强大的基础设施 阿里云作为全球顶尖的云计算服务提供商,拥有庞大的数据中心网络和领先的基础设施技术。其数据中心分布在全球各地,包括中国、亚太、欧洲和美国等地区,为用户提供更强的稳定性和高速的连接。 2. 安全可靠的保障 阿里云具备行业领先的安全能力,采用了多种安全策略来保护用户的数据和应用。其数据中心采用严格的物理安全措…

    2024年1月10日
    64600
  • 阿里云企业邮箱的按季度付费价格优势在哪?

    阿里云企业邮箱按季度付费价格优势分析 随着互联网的快速发展,企业对于电子邮件的需求也愈发增加。阿里云作为国内领先的云服务提供商,推出了企业邮箱服务,为企业用户提供稳定、安全、高效的邮件通讯解决方案。与传统的年付费模式相比,阿里云企业邮箱的按季度付费价格具有诸多优势。 优势一:灵活性强 按季度付费模式使得企业可以根据实际需求,灵活调整邮箱账号数量和服务期限。在…

    2024年10月17日
    56200

发表回复

登录后才能评论

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/